The Metric Viton O-Rings are the go-to choice for specialized applications requiring superior sealing properties. Compliant with stringent standards, these O-rings boast exceptional mechanical strength and compression set resistance. The Viton material ensures excellent memory and rapid recovery from deformation, with a Shore A hardness of 75. Operating between -10°F to +300°F (-23°C to +150°C), these O-Rings are ideal for encapsulated applications in industries such as military, automotive, and defense. Trust in the reliability and durability of these metric standard O-Rings for heightened performance and longevity.
